Monday’s first kick-off at the 2026 World Cup will see Belgium and Egypt do battle in Seattle, where the pair will clash at Lumen Field. 

Hotly tipped for success at several major tournaments in the last decade, the Red Devils have typically failed to live up to expectations on the biggest stage. Now that they’re flying under the radar, can they be more successful? For the Egyptians, there has been little World Cup success to shout about. The Pharaohs will be appearing at the tournament for the first time since 2018, and will be hoping to qualify for the knockouts for the first time since 1934. 

The Belgians couldn’t really have asked for a better opening-round opportunity. The Egyptians can sit deep and frustrate, but they don’t pack much of an offensive punch and are likely to be overpowered by a team that has much more final-third quality, so much so that the Belgian win could easily be priced shorter than odds of -149.

Belgium - Egypt: Form Analysis

The Red Devils delivered two strong displays during their warm-up campaign, with Rudi Garcia’s men first beating a decent Croatia team by two goals to zero, before they really stepped on the gas against Tunisia, scoring five goals without reply on their way to a comprehensive victory. During that game, we saw what this Belgian team can do offensively, so the Egyptians will need to be disciplined defensively if they’re to get a result here.

It’s been far less exciting from the Pharaohs over the last few weeks. Following their disappointing quarter-final exit at AFCON around six months ago, they delivered a decent display to beat Saudi Arabia by four goals to zero in March, but that display has not paved the way for a more free-scoring Egypt, with Hossam Hassan’s men scoring only two goals in three games since. They prepared for the big tournament by defeating Russia 1-0, before losing 2-1 to Brazil.
